LAS VEGAS — The Mets have opened talks with Pete Alonso, and at least on the surface there seems to be a better feeling around those talks this year than last.
The nice start to discussions could possibly bode well for the Mets’ chances to retain Alonso . But his market should be much more robust this year than last year after a much better season, no qualifying offer attachment and an apparent willingness to do more DHing despite being a year older.
